Receive a Line Terminated by CRLF

See more Socket/SSL/TLS Examples

Demonstrates Socket.ReceiveToCRLF, which receives text through a CRLF line terminator and returns the text including the terminator.

Background. Chilkat encodes CR followed by LF using StringCharset and searches the incoming byte stream for that exact sequence. This is convenient for line-oriented text protocols.

Dim success As Boolean = False

Dim socket As New Chilkat.Socket

'  Connect to the server using TLS.  The 3rd argument enables the TLS handshake after the TCP
'  connection succeeds; the 4th is the maximum time to wait, in milliseconds.
Dim bTls As Boolean = True
Dim maxWaitMs As Integer = 5000
success = socket.Connect("example.com",5000,bTls,maxWaitMs)
If (success = False) Then
    Debug.WriteLine(socket.LastErrorText)
    Exit Sub
End If


'  StringCharset controls the character encoding used when sending and receiving text.
socket.StringCharset = "utf-8"
'  Send a request using a simple application-defined text protocol in which each message ends with a
'  CRLF.
Dim command As String = "STATUS" & vbCrLf
success = socket.SendString(command)
If (success = False) Then
    Debug.WriteLine(socket.LastErrorText)
    Exit Sub
End If


'  Receive text through a CRLF line terminator, returning the text including the terminator.  This is
'  convenient for line-oriented text protocols in which each response is a CRLF-terminated line.
Dim responseLine As String = socket.ReceiveToCRLF()
If (socket.LastMethodSuccess = False) Then
    Debug.WriteLine(socket.LastErrorText)
    Exit Sub
End If

Debug.WriteLine(responseLine)
